perf hists: Remove hist_entry->used, not used anymore
authorArnaldo Carvalho de Melo <acme@redhat.com>
Tue, 17 Mar 2015 20:18:58 +0000 (17:18 -0300)
committerArnaldo Carvalho de Melo <acme@redhat.com>
Tue, 17 Mar 2015 20:18:58 +0000 (17:18 -0300)
Since hist_entry__delete() nowadays doesn't actually frees anything that
may be in use by the annotation code.

Eventually we will solve this for good by reference counting struct
symbol.
